Lets compare vitamin content per 14 ounces of Oven-heated Frozen French Fries vs Boiled California Red Kidney Beans:
- 14 ounces of Oven-heated Frozen French Fries have 4.1 times more Vitamin B3, 2.4 times more Vitamin B5, 1.8 times more Vitamin B6 and 11.1 times more Vitamin C than Boiled California Red Kidney Beans.
- While 14 oz of Boiled California Red Kidney Beans contain 2 times more Vitamin B2 and 2.6 times more Vitamin B9 than Oven-heated Frozen French Fried Potatoes.
- Both Oven-heated Frozen French Fries and Boiled California Red Kidney Beans provide similar amounts of Vitamin B1 per 14 ounces.
- 14 ounces of Boiled California Red Kidney Beans have insufficient amounts of Vitamin C
- Both Oven-heated Frozen French Fried Potatoes as well as Boiled California Red Kidney Beans have insufficient amounts of Vitamin D in 14 ounces.
Comparing minerals per 14 ounces for Oven-heated Frozen French Fries vs Boiled California Red Kidney Beans:
- 14 ounces of Oven-heated Frozen French Fries have 8 times more Sodium than Boiled California Red Kidney Beans.
- While 14 oz of Boiled California Red Kidney Beans contain 5.5 times more Calcium, 2.1 times more Copper, 4 times more Iron, 1.8 times more Magnesium, 1.5 times more Manganese, 1.4 times more Phosphorus, 6 times more Selenium and 2.3 times more Zinc than Oven-heated Frozen French Fried Potatoes.
- Both Oven-heated Frozen French Fries and Boiled California Red Kidney Beans contain similar levels of Potassium per 14 ounces.
- 14 ounces of Oven-heated Frozen French Fries lack sufficient amounts of Calcium and Selenium
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 14 ounces:
- 14 ounces of Oven-heated Frozen French Fries have 1.4 times more Energy, 58 times more Fat, 73.5 times more Saturated Fat and 1.3 times more Carbohydrate than Boiled California Red Kidney Beans.
- While 14 oz of Boiled California Red Kidney Beans contain 1.5 times more Omega 3, 3.6 times more Fiber and 3.4 times more Protein than Oven-heated Frozen French Fried Potatoes.
- 14 ounces of Oven-heated Frozen French Fries provide inadequate amounts of Omega 3
- Both Oven-heated Frozen French Fried Potatoes as well as Boiled California Red Kidney Beans provide inadequate amounts of Omega 6 in 14 ounces.
